Hi all . I originally ' bodged ' the Tamiya Panther G road wheels onto my Pantiger conversion . I have now made some steel inserts that fit into the Tamiya wheels and drilled them so that the standard HL pins go through them. Ive got to decide if Im happy how they sit on the Pantiger (see under view pict ) As I have used the Tamiya parts designed to go inside the wheel as spacers .Also I have the skirts to fit . I then need to adjust the drive sprocket and get a set of adjustable track tensioners .

Hi thanks mate . Theres a lot of work involved . But I like the Panther Ausf.A and thought it would be easyer to alter my old Pantiger than chop up the new HL Panther G . I have used a new HL Panther G turret though but back dated to the A model and Tamiya Panther G road wheels and the correct Panther width tracks not the old HL Tiger/Pantiger ones that were just correct for the Tiger and to wide for the Panthers.
